Important Notice Regarding Your Username & Password

It has come to our attention that unsolicited email has been sent to many of our customers in an attempt to obtain their username and password by deception, as this message purports to come from us at the Internet Centre. This type of deception has become known as "phishing".

An example of the email which was sent is shown at the end of this warning.

PLEASE NOTE:

We will NEVER ask for your username and password in a general email of this nature.

If we have been specifically requested by you to help with a technical support matter, we may ask in response for the username affected.

If we are creating a NEW account or resetting a password, at YOUR request, we might ask for the new password that you want us to set.

These are the ONLY times when we should ask you for this information, and it's always in response to a request from you. Please do not reply to emails of the type shown below.

If you ever have any doubt about whether emails originated from us, please send an email to: support@incentre.net.

If you DID respond to an email like the one below, please change your password. If you don't know how, please ask.
